Aggregative activation in heterocyclic chemistry. Part 5.† Lithiation of pyridine and quinoline with the complex base BuLi·Me2N(CH2)2OLi (BuLi·LiDMAE)
Abstract
It is shown that the complex base BuLi·LiDMAE reacts with pyridine to give metallated species which, after trapping by electrophiles, lead to 2-substituted pyridines in good to excellent yields. The same reactions have been less successfully performed with quinoline.
